Victoria records 278 new coronavirus cases and eight deaths

Today's numbers represent the lowest daily death toll since August 6.

The increase of 278 is the first time the state's daily number of new cases has dipped below 300 in more than two weeks, and is Victoria's lowest daily increase since July 20, when it reported 275 cases. Stage 4 restrictions were first imposed on Melbourne about 10 days ago, including a strict night-time curfew and limiting people's movements to within a 5 kilometre radius of their home.

Other measures as part of stage 4, such as closing many businesses and limiting access to childcare, only took effect halfway through last week. Premier Daniel Andrews has said in recent days it was too early to determine the exact effect stage 4 restrictions were having on case numbers.More to come.
